Ricky Ponting steps in with a four-year vision to rebuild PBKS from scratch. He sees this as “Project Punjab,” a challenge he relishes. His track record includes an IPL title with Mumbai Indians. According to SportsTak, Ponting refuses to accept mediocrity, demanding excellence. He’s already shaping a dynamic coaching staff for 2025.
The mega auction gave him a clean slate to craft his ideal team. Ponting’s focus on young talent and big names is strategic. Will his bold approach pay off? PBKS’s home record—two wins in 14 games—needs fixing, and he’s determined. His passion could finally make Punjab a fortress.
Arshdeep Singh Has To Deliver Magic
Arshdeep Singh remains PBKS’s bowling spearhead, retained for INR 18 crore. Last IPL, he took 19 wickets but struggled with consistency. In 2024, he topped T20I wicket-takers with 36 scalps. His late-year turnaround shows growth, which is vital for PBKS’s success. As per BBC Sport, Arshdeep is now India’s highest T20I wicket-taker.
Ponting will lean on him to lead the pace attack. Pairing him with Lockie Ferguson could be lethal. Will he deliver in crunch moments? A strong Arshdeep could make PBKS’s bowling a playoff weapon. His evolution is key to their plans. He was part of India National Cricket Team Squad for the CT 2025, which won the trophy.

Who is Priyansh Arya?
Priyansh Arya steps into IPL 2025 as PBKS’s most intriguing wildcard pick. His jaw-dropping six-sixes-in-an-over in the Delhi Premier League stunned cricket fans. At INR 3.8 crore, he’s a high-stakes investment with massive upside.
As per ESPNcricinfo, Arya’s 102 off 43 balls against Uttar Pradesh was pure dynamite. He smashed 10 sixes and five fours, dismantling a strong bowling attack. Opening alongside Josh Inglis or Prabhsimran Singh could suit his aggressive style.
His signature down-the-ground sixes bring a fearless edge PBKS desperately needs. Ricky Ponting’s coaching expertise might refine this raw, explosive talent. Will Arya handle the IPL’s pressure-cooker environment?
A breakout season could catapult him into India’s next big batting sensation. PBKS fans dream of him lighting up Mullanpur with towering hits. His Delhi Premier League strike rate of 198.69 hints at greatness.
With Iyer’s guidance, Arya might anchor the top order in crucial games. The franchise hopes he’s the spark to ignite their playoff push. This young gun could redefine PBKS’s batting identity.

Who is Suryansh Shedge?
Suryansh Shedge, a 22-year-old allrounder, could emerge as PBKS’s secret weapon in 2025. His Syed Mushtaq Ali Trophy exploits caught everyone’s attention last season. Bought for just INR 30 lakh, he’s a bargain with huge potential.
SportsTak said Shedge’s composure under pressure helped Mumbai clinch the title. He smashed three sixes and three fours in the final, batting at No. 6. Replacing Ashutosh Sharma as an Impact Player seems like a natural fit.
His 15-ball cameo in that final showcased his ability to finish tight games. Ricky Ponting’s keen eye for young talent identified Shedge early on. Can he translate domestic success to the IPL’s grand stage?
A robust lower order with Shedge could turn PBKS’s close losses into wins. His fearless approach suits the aggressive style Iyer and Ponting demand. Fans are buzzing about his potential debut fireworks.
Shedge’s versatility with bat and ball adds depth to an already stacked squad. If he fires, PBKS might finally solve their late-order woes. The youngster could be a game-changer in crunch moments.
